Geographical Uniqueness of Burundi

Geographical Uniqueness of Burundi

Burundi’s topography, nestled within the Congo-Nile Divide, presents unique geographical advantages. While it may lack a coastline, Burundi’s interior boasts a tapestry of rolling hills, lush forests, and rich plains.

Gambia: A Coastal Haven

Gambia: A Coastal Haven

Gambia’s position as the smallest country on mainland Africa makes it unique on the continent. Despite its modest size of 10,120 square kilometers, it makes the most of its geography with a diverse and vibrant ecosystem.

Burundi's Economic Pulse

Burundi's Economic Pulse

Despite economic challenges, Burundi holds untapped potential for growth and development. The country's economy is driven by agriculture, with coffee and tea as its key exports, underscoring its connection to global markets.

Burundi's Promising Trade Dynamics

Burundi's Promising Trade Dynamics

Burundi stands out with a unique trade profile among the 193 countries analyzed. Its export basket is primarily dominated by agricultural products, most notably coffee and tea, accounting for over 64% of its exports.
